Backend: Puma Apdex: slow requests for GraphqlController#execute: getCiConfigData and getPipeline
As a part of investigating our error budget we would like to look into the slow requests for GraphqlController#execute: getCiConfigData and getPipeline
| Enpoint | 7days average | User Impact |
|---|---|---|
| GraphqlController#execute: getCiConfigData and getPipeline | Is there a user impact? |
Investigation
| Description | Issue link |
|---|---|
| GroupDestroyWorker failure - ci_pipeline_variables (reassigned to ~"group::workspace") | |
| Sidekiq Execution Apdex: slow jobs for Ci::ExternalPullRequests::CreatePipelineWorker | #349976 (closed) |
| Puma Errors: failing requests for GraphqlController#execute | #349973 (closed) |
| Puma Apdex: slow requests GET /api/:version/projects/:id/ci/lint | #349971 (closed) |
| Puma Errors: failing requests for GET /api/:version/projects/:id/ci/lint | #349972 (closed) |
| Puma Errors: failing requests for Projects::Ci::LintsController#create | #349974 (closed) |
| Puma Errors: failing requests Projects::Ci::PipelineEditorController#show | #349975 (closed) |
| Puma Apdex: slow requests GET /api/:version/projects/:id/variables | #349970 (closed) |
| Puma Apdex: slow requests for GET /api/:version/projects/:id/pipelines/:pipeline_id/variables | #349969 (closed) |
| Puma Apdex: slow requests for GraphqlController#execute: getCiConfigData and getPipeline |
|
| Puma Apdex: failing requests for GraphqlController#execute: getCiConfigData - conversion exceptions | #362547 (closed) |
Prioritization Table
| Title | Issue Link |
|---|---|
| Backend: Add better logging to config_compose and config_mapper_process | #367899 (closed) - Blocker issue |
| Backend: Puma Apdex: slow requests for GraphqlController#execute: getCiConfigData and getPipeline |
|
Edited by Mark Nuzzo